Meet the Instructors: Medhat Rakha

Medhat Rakha

Organization/Location
Department of Mathematics and Statistics, Sultan Qaboos University, Oman
Department of Mathematics, Suez Canal University, Egypt

Degrees
B.S. in Mathematics, The University of Benghazi, Libya
M.S. in Mathematics, Suez Canal University, Egypt
Ph.D. in Mathematics, Suez Canal University and Texas A&M University

Teaching Experience
Medhat Rakha began his academic career in 1993 as a mathematics lecturer in the Department of Mathematics, Suez Canal University, Ismailia, Egypt. In 1998, he obtained a Ph.D. in algebra and special functions and was promoted to assistant professor. Rakha has taught courses in a wide range of topics in pure and applied mathematics. He began teaching Mathematica courses in 1999, and organized the first Mathematica workshop in the Middle East, titled "Mathematica in Education and Research," held in Ismailia, Egypt, in 2001. He is currently on sabbatical leave at the Department of Mathematics and Statistics, College of Science, Sultan Qaboos University, Muscat, Oman.

Mathematica Experience
Rakha has been using Mathematica since 1994, in the research areas of Lie algebra and special functions. He has used Mathematica in many of his publications. He incorporates Mathematica in his specialized university courses in linear and abstract algebras. With the support of UNESCO and Wolfram Research Europe Ltd., Rakha organized the 2004 Mathematica Gulf Conference at Sultan Qaboos University.

Language Fluency
English and Arabic

Interests
Computational algebra, basic and multivariate hypergeometric series, q-Beta integrals
